**Vendor note: Inkmill markdown pipeline**

Rendering for Parchway docs is outsourced to Inkmill under an annual contract, renewing each March. They handle sanitization and PDF export; we own the upload queue. SLA: 4-hour response on rendering failures. Escalate only after two failed retries. Their support desk is reachable at the address below.

billing contact of hahaf-baguf = zorael.tammir.jorius@sivrelhq.internal

**14:22** — Contractor note: the Bramblehut firmware update channel began serving the beta manifest to stable-ring devices after a config merge error. Roughly 300 thermostats pulled the wrong image before the channel was frozen at 14:31. No devices bricked; all rolled back automatically. The offending manifest push is traceable via the token below.

pipeline stamp: htk31_f769b577b3028a4e9958e5bb8d1259a

Migration step 4 — Quantifold assignment service. Move the bucketing keys from the legacy Torchline vault to the new Quantifold secrets layer before cutover. Assignments remain deterministic during the move because the hash salt is versioned, not replaced. Audit scope: confirm no plaintext salts persist in the legacy layer after the sync completes. The configuration values in effect during the migration window are reproduced below.

service settings:
PRAWYN_PIN=9848
PRAWYN_METRICS_HOST=metrics.prawyn.lumicworks.corp
PRAWYN_LOG_LEVEL=warn
PRAWYN_TENANT=pelius